    Device Mobility Related Settings

    The parameters under these settings will override the device-level settings only when the device is roaming within a Device Mobility Group. The parameters included in these settings are:

    Device Mobility Calling Search Space
    AAR Calling Search Space
    AAR Group
    Calling Party Transformation CSS
